Nifrel

ニフレル

Expocity, Suita · near Banpaku-kinen-koen (5 min walk)

Nifrel in Expocity, Suita. A 'living museum' blending aquarium and zoo where animals roam in open zones - whitetip sharks, a white tiger, penguins, capybara and free-flying birds - with immersive art and light installations.

Why children love it: A 'living museum' blending aquarium and zoo where animals roam in open zones - whitetip sharks, a white tiger, penguins, capybara and free-flying birds - with immersive art and light installations.

Honest drawbacks: Compact and popular, so it can feel crowded; the roaming-animal zones mean a bit of care with very small children.

Opening hours
Generally 10:00-18:00 (last entry 17:00); hours vary seasonally. Inside the Expocity complex; same-day re-entry allowed.
Price
Ages 16+ ¥2,400, ages 7-15 ¥1,200, ages 3-6 ¥700, under 3 free.
